Elderly people who consume olive oil have a lower risk of stroke than those not taking it, researchers said, in a study released on Wednesday (15 / 6) in the United States.
Some scientists at the National Institute of Health and Medical Research in Bordeaux, France, followed a 7625 French people aged 65 years and over, from three major cities - Bordeaux, Dijon and Montpellier - for five years.
